Vegetarian Paella:
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 small onion (chopped)
- 3 garlic cloves (minced)
- 1 red bell pepper (sliced)
- 1 yellow bell pepper (sliced)
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
- 1 cup green beans (trimmed and halved)
- 1 cup artichoke hearts (canned or marinated, quartered)
- 1 cup arborio or short-grain rice
- 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on turmeric or saffron threads
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 3 cups vegetable broth (warm)
- 1/2 cup frozen peas
- lemon wedges and chopped f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et. Add onion, cook until softened.
- Stir in garlic, bell peppers, green beans. Add cherry tomatoes, artichoke hearts.
- Add rice, paprika, turmeric/saffron, salt, pepper. Toast rice, pour in broth.
- Simmer for 15-18 minutes without stirring. Add peas in last 5 minutes.
- Remove from heat, let rest. Garnish with parsley, lemon wedges.
Notes
- Use saffron for authentic flavor, turmeric is a budget-friendly option.
- Avoid stirring rice to achieve a crusty bottom layer (socarrat).
